
Game Overview
A colossal turtle drifting through space serves as both setting and sanctuary in a surreal 2D action-platformer with a striking biological twist. Its organs become explorable regions: pulsing arteries act as transit routes, neural pathways flash with energy, and digestive chambers turn into hostile environmental obstacles. The tone balances colorful, strange cartoon sci-fi with genuine pressure, as the Curative Agents defend their living home from ravenous parasites threatening to consume it from within.
Moonlight Pulse centers on a small squad whose members can be swapped instantly, letting you combine distinct movement options and combat specialties while navigating its interconnected world. One character’s ability may open a route or create an escape opportunity, while another is better suited to dealing with aggressive enemies, encouraging smart team management rather than relying on a single hero. New powers arrive alongside each agent’s personal storyline, steadily broadening traversal and battle options as previously unreachable areas become accessible. Failure has real consequences: the adventure ends if even one teammate dies, but endangered allies can be rescued before disaster becomes permanent, making positioning and quick reactions vital during frantic encounters.
The living-world concept gives familiar Metroidvania-style exploration an unusually memorable identity, with the environment constantly feeling like an enormous creature rather than a collection of disconnected levels. Branching vessels provide fast travel across the turtle’s body, while larger parasite encounters escalate into multi-phase boss fights that test every member of the team. Tight controls, expressive environments, and Johann “treehann” Theo’s energetic soundtrack help sell the strange atmosphere, though a controller is clearly the preferred way to play. Players who enjoy character-switching platformers, interconnected maps, and action with some co-op-like rescue tension should find plenty to like, especially if games such as Guacamelee! or Shantae appeal to them.
